The Rock confirmed for first Smackdown on FOX

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son has announced that he will be appearing live at the 20th anniversary Smackdown episode on FOX this coming Friday, his first WWE televised appearance since WrestleMania 32.

WWE and Johnson, along with FOX, were in discussions for the special appearance but The Rock’s schedule had to be cleared for him to be able to travel to the STAPLES Center.

“FINALLY…I come back home to my @WWE universe. This FRIDAY NIGHT, I’ll return for our debut of SMACKDOWN! LIVE,” Johnson wrote in a tweet. “There’s no greater title than #thepeopleschamp. And there’s no place like home. Tequila on me after the show,” he added, writing the hash tags #IfYaSmell, #Smackdown #RocksShow, and #FOX.

The word Smackdown is largely attributed to The Rock after he used it in one of his promos in the late 90s. WWE eventually went ahead with the word as the title of their new show.

The Rock will be joined by Stone Cold Steve Austin, Ric Flair, Hulk Hogan, Mick Foley, Sting, Goldberg, Trish Stratus, and many others as special guests.
